Track the permissions that have been given out to each picture.

This should make it easier to know what can be done to a buffer once
it's been passed to your filter without falling back to copying it "just
to be safe".

/**
* A linked list of filters which reference this picture and the permissions
* they each have. This is needed for the case that filter A requests a buffer
* from filter B. Filter B gives it a buffer to use with the permissions it
* requested, while reserving more permissions for itself to use when filter A
* eventually passes the buffer to filter B. However, filter A does not know
* what these permissions are to reinsert them in the reference passed to B,
* filter B can't assume that any picture it is passed is one that it allocated.
*
* Rather than have each filter implement their own code to check for this
* case, we store all the permissions here in the picture structure.
*
* Because the number of filters holding references to any one picture should
* be rather low, this should not be a major source of performance problems.
*/
typedef struct AVFilterPicPerms
{
AVFilterContext *filter; ///< the filter
int perms; ///< the permissions that filter has
struct AVFilterPicPerms *next;
} AVFilterPicPerms;
